The History of Mince Pies
Mince pies have a rich history that dates back centuries. Originally, these pies were much larger and contained actual minced meat, rather than the sweet fruit mixture we know today. The tradition of serving mince pies during the festive season began in medieval England, where they were seen as a symbol of prosperity and goodwill. Over time, the recipe evolved to include dried fruits, spices, and brandy, creating the modern version we enjoy today.
Evolution of the Recipe
The evolution of mince pies reflects changes in culinary preferences and availability of ingredients. During the 16th century, the addition of exotic spices like c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ves became common, thanks to increased trade routes. By the 19th century, the recipe had shifted to focus more on sweetness, with the inclusion of sugar and candied fruits. Today, mince pies remain a staple of Christmas celebrations in the UK.

Making Your Own Mince Pies
For those who prefer a more personalized touch, making your own mince pies can be a rewarding experience. Here's a simple recipe to get you started:
Ingredients
- 250g plain flour
- 125g unsalted butter
- 50g caster sugar
- 1 egg yolk
- 1 tbsp cold water
- 500g ready-made mincemeat
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 180°C (160°C fan).
- Mix the flour, butter, and sugar until it resembles fine breadcrumbs.
- Add the egg yolk and water, kneading until the dough comes together.
- Roll out the dough and cut circles for the base and lid of the pies.
- Place a spoonful of mincemeat in each base and cover with the lid.
- Bake for 20-25 minutes until golden brown.

Mince Pie Sales and Trends
According to recent statistics, the UK market for mince pies is thriving. In 2023, over 300 million mince pies were sold, with sales expected to increase in 2024. Consumers are increasingly drawn to premium options and innovative flavors, reflecting a growing appreciation for quality and variety.
Consumer Preferences
A survey conducted by a leading supermarket revealed that 60% of respondents prefer store-bought mince pies for convenience, while 40% enjoy making their own at home. This balance highlights the enduring appeal of both traditional and modern approaches.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. Are mince pies only eaten during Christmas?
While traditionally associated with Christmas, mince pies can be enjoyed year-round. However, their popularity peaks during the festive season.
2. What is the best way to store mince pies?
Mince pies should be st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to five days. For longer storage, they can be frozen for up to three months.
3. Can I freeze homemade mince pies?
Yes, homemade mince pies can be frozen. Allow them to cool completely before wrapping them individually in cling film and placing them in a freezer-safe container.
